Support Students to Become Young Entrepreneurs, Skystar Ventures and CDC UMN Hold Career Building
September 29, 2021Prospective Data Scientist, Yuk Master This To Be Seen By Today’s Companies
September 30, 2021Data is a collection of facts to give a broad picture of a situation. A person who will take a policy or decision will generally use the data as a consideration. Through data one can analyze, describe, or explain a situation.
In general, data is widely used for a particular study. However, over time, data is needed to meet various needs in various fields. Of course, this aims to provide clear and correct information after the data is processed further. To process the data requires the profession of Data Engineer. Here is a complete explanation of the profession that many of these companies are looking for.
1. What is a Data Engineer
In short, the profession of Data Engineer is a person who organizes and manages data architecture processes in a company. The infrastructure here is in the form of databases, pipelines, or warehouses. They are tasked with building a system that can be integrated with other systems so that it can process larger-scale data easily.
Of course, if you want to become a Data Engineer you need logical skills, knowledge of databases, and programming languages. But to become a Data Engineer do not need to have a background in data education, but you still have to master these technical skills, such as:
- Programming language
Programming languages are crucial for a data scientist. With the program language you can perform numerical analysis, and statistics with large data sets. SQL (Structured Query Language) is a program language designed to manage data in relational databases and is currently the most commonly used method for accessing data in databases.
- Knowledge in the Field of Scripting
Scripting languages are used to translate code or commands within a site. You will use scripting to make the data more legible and can be more easily processed by the data manager.
- Proficient in cloud
“Cloud” stands for “cloud computing” or cloud computing, and the term refers to tasks and services provided or hosted on the internet on a pay-to-use basis. People may have long been able to store, operate, and manage data over the internet, but cloud computing is a paid service that does all this on a much larger scale.
At its core, the cloud is a digital storage unit that can store all your files; The difference is that if in a storage unit you have to be physically present to access your files, in the cloud you can access them from any device as long as the device has a connection to the internet.
Also read Belajar Data Science Secara Otodidak? Berikut langkah-langkahnya!
2. Job Description Seorang Data Engineer
Of course, the work that will be done by data engineers is not far from the capabilities that must be possessed as above. Then, anything that needs to be prepared if you want to plunge into the world of Data Engineer. Here is the job desk of a data engineer.
- Collecting and Processing Data
Each company certainly only has one source of information, therefore a Data Engineer will collect and develop data according to the needs of the company. Of course, when taking data need high caution because if the wrong input data will make invalid results.
- Cleaning Data
Second, a data engineer must be able to clean up the data after it is combined, then be able to look for anomalies in the information. Is that an anomaly? It is a process in a database that produces side effects that are not expected by data engineers.
This is usually due to the structure of the table that combines data that is still dirty and invalid because it still contains null values. So it needs special methods or treatments to be able to overcome this, where you must have expertise in making good decisions.
- Improving Data Warehouse Architecture
Data Engineers also have the task of designing the architectural structure of the data warehouse that is successfully analyzed. Which, various data that has been cleaned will be entered into the data warehouse. After that, you can simply design the data storage flow in the software (software) by defining the structure of the model using DFD, ERD, and other architectures.
3. Differences in Data Engineer, Data Scientist, and Data Analyst
The most fundamental difference between these three professions is in processing data. Where a data is first processed and processed by a data engineer. Then, after cleaning, it will be continued by data analysts to separate data that is considered important and less important, and classify various categories of data to be more easily readable by stakeholders.
Tasks from data analysts include analyzing data, reading business directions, interpreting data, and more. A Data Analyst must also have the skills to be a good Data Analyst. You must be able to mathematics and statistics, be able to analyze, present and interpret data.
The ability of a Data Scientist is not only used for coding, but also able to turn unstructured data sets into something that is easier for ordinary people to understand. As a Data Scientist is also tasked to understand business because the company needs services to produce product recommendations to be offered to consumers.
Also read Mulai Belajar Data Science GRATIS bersama DQLab selama 1 Bulan Sekarang!
4. Build Your Data Career With DQLab
Let’s build your career now together with DQLab online learning platform! Many facilities provided by DQLab for you loh.
- Quiz
DQLab itself provides quiz-quiz that can be accessed to test how much you understand the material delivered. With this quiz you can also see how well you do data analysis.
- Sign Up and get a Free Module
Sign up to get the FREE module “Introduction to Data Science” Module is available in the form of R language as well as Python. Both programming languages are the most widely used.
- Live Code Editor
With the LIve code editor for you can learn and directly apply it in practice in real time. There is a timer that can keep you from being idle for 30 minutes from the start of the session. This feature is used as a system protection mechanism in learning sessions at DQLab and ensures the security of user data.
- Certificate
Taking a certificate makes you more proficient in the field you are taking. Once you have successfully completed the modules in DQLab you will get a “Certificate of Completion”. With this you are one step ahead of becoming a data practitioner.
By John Ricky & Annissa Widya | DQLab
Kuliah di Jakarta untuk jurusan program studi Informatika| Sistem Informasi | Teknik Komputer | Teknik Elektro | Teknik Fisika | Akuntansi | Manajemen| Komunikasi Strategis | Jurnalistik | Desain Komunikasi Visual | Film dan Animasi | Arsitektur | D3 Perhotelan | International Program, di Universitas Multimedia Nusantara. www.umn.ac.id